"The NCI trials, conducted in Linxian, China, with a population at high risk for esophageal cancer, noted a significant benefit for those receiving a P-carotene/vitamin E/selenium combination—a 13% decrease in the cancer mortality rate, a 21% decrease in stomach cancer mortality, a 4% decrease in esophageal cancer mortality, a 10% decrease in deaths from strokes, and a 9% decrease in deaths from all causes [35]. The general-izability of these findings from Linxian may not be universally appropriate because individuals in this study appear to have limited intakes of several micronutrients." - Ann M. Coulston and Carol J. Boushey, Nutrition in the Prevention and Treatment of Disease (Get the book.)

| "The glutamic acid 487 lysine polymorphism in the ALDH2 gene and the arginine 399 glutamine polymorphism in the XRCC1 gene are both associated with an increased risk of esophageal cancer in individuals consuming a low-selenium diet. Additionally, this risk becomes even more pronounced in individuals who smoke or consume alcohol [105]. This may reflect the individual pharmokinetics in handling supplemental selenium." - Ann M. Coulston and Carol J. Boushey, Nutrition in the Prevention and Treatment of Disease (Get the book.)
| "A cancer registry in China identified 902 esophageal cancer patients, and another 1,552 cancer-free men and women were included in the study as controls. All of these men and women were interviewed to gather information about diet, medical history, smoking status, alcohol use, tea drinking habits, family history of cancer, occupation, physical activity, and reproductive history. Statistical analysis of the data showed that alcohol users and cigarette smokers have "risk reductions [for developing esophageal cancer] of about 20% among male and 50% among female drinkers of green tea." - Lester A. Mitscher and Victoria Toews, The Green Tea Book (Get the book.)

| "Glutamine protected lymphocytes and intestinal integrity in patients with advanced esophageal cancer in a randomized, placebo-controlled study. Patients receiving active treatment (n=7) were given 30 g of oral glutamine daily for 28 days at the start of radiochemotherapy. Placebo-treated patients (n=6) received a standard amino acid solution. All patient received 5-fluorouracil and cisplatin plus mediastinal irradiation. Blood chemistries, lymphocyte counts, and gut barrier functions were completed before treatment and on days 7, 14, and 28." - Thomson Healthcare, Inc., PDR for Herbal Medicines, Fourth Edition (Get the book.)

| "Riboflavin deficiency has been associated with an increased incidence of esophageal cancer in certain parts of the world. Riboflavin supplementation has been found to reduce the prevalence of micronuclei in esophageal cells in a study performed in Huixan, People's Republic of China. Micro-nuclei are considered precancerous lesions. People living in this region have a high risk of esophageal cancer and poor riboflavin status. It remains unclear, however, whether riboflavin supplementation can decrease the incidence of esophageal cancer." - Sheldon Saul Hendler and David Rorvik, PDR for Nutritional Supplements (Get the book.)

| "For example, in 1994 the Journal of the National Cancer Institute published the results of an epidemiological study indicating that drinking green tea reduced the risk of esophageal cancer in Chinese men and women by nearly 60 percent. And in 2004, a team from Harvard Medical School reported that EGCG (the catechin in green tea mentioned earlier) inhibits the growth and reproduction of cancer cells associated with Barrett's esophagus. They said that green tea may help lower the prevalence of esophageal adenocarcinoma, one of the fastest-growing cancers in Western countries." - Jonny Bowden, Ph.D., C.N.S., The 150 Healthiest Foods on Earth: The Surprising, Unbiased Truth About What You Should Eat and Why (Get the book.)
